I'm sure anybody who knows a little about boxing knows who Danny Williams is, wasn't ever really world level but well known domestically and famously beat Mike Tyson in 2004 (although Tyson was well past his best),then went on to fight Vitali Klitscho and then a few big domestic fights against people like Audley Harrison and Matt Skelton. Last half decent opponent was Derek Chisora in 2010, when he lost his British title at Upton Park.

Was obvious at this point that he'd had it, and he promised he was going to retire, but kept going. The BBBofC refused to hand him a license in 2012 and have refused to give him one ever since (detached retina).

In the last two and a half years he has been going all over the place fighting nobodies in any country who will give him a license and a purse, has lost 12 of his last 14 fights against people who can't win a fight themselves (e.g. lost to a boxer who had won 8 lost 45 in December),basically being used as fodder to boost records of journeymen or to given debutants moral boosting first-fight success.

Really sad state of affairs, he is 41 and obviously completely punch drunk - he is going to end up mentally and physically disabled I think, after every fight he says he is going to retire and a couple of months later he is back in the ring taking serious beatings. The bloke managed 8 rounds with Vitali a decade ago, but is taking serious beatings every couple of months at the minute, some licensed and some not. 

Nothing anybody can actually do about this, the BBBofC can only refuse to issue a license to fight in the UK, he can fight abroad, and there is still nothing stopping him from fighting unlicensed in the UK (unlicensed boxing is not illegal). Just a shame that he doesn't seem to have the right people around him. Watched a couple of his recent fights on YouTube, made really uncomfortable viewing.  

This interview was from a year ago, obviously punch drunk and he's had 11 fights since.... After every fight he says he's retiring, including the interview below. One year, 11 fights (9 defeats) later and he's still going.... he has been KO'd at least 7 times in 4 years.

Yeah, very sad.  In one of my all time favourite fights, he won the British title with a dislocated shoulder, knocking out his opponent in the 6th round (same round his shoulder gave out) and after beating Tyson I hoped he'd have a better crack at it - never quite seemed all there to me even before this, but this is really sad to see.  I guess he has no other kind of way to earn an income because there's nothing else that could be driving him to destruction like this.
